摘要
The results of tests and calculations leading to the determination of the effect of the frame rigidity and the effect of the foundation mass on the vibrations of a pump rotor are presented. It is established that an increase in the frame rigidity causes a linear increase in the rotor vibration amplitudes in the bearing cross sections.
